Country/Territory Norway Document type Date 2009 Source FAO, FAOLEX Subject Fisheries Keyword Aquaculture Basic legislation Sustainable development Sustainable use Mariculture Aquatic animals Fish disease Animal feed/feedstuffs Precautionary principle Protection of species Research Genetic resources Policy/planning Fishery management and conservation Geographical area Europe, EUROPE AND CENTRAL ASIA, North Atlantic, North Sea, North-East Atlantic, Northern Europe Abstract The Strategy for an Environmentally Sustainable Norwegian Aquaculture Industry is a national strategy that focuses on the environmental aspects of sustainable farming. The strategy document discusses details of challenges, status, measures initiated, future goals and the Government’s proposals for new measures. Full text English Website www.regjeringen.no
